Optical fiber sensor is gradually accompanied by the development of optical communication technology. It integrates information collection and transmission in one optical fiber. Its advantages of high sensitivity, long distance monitoring and accurate location have been discussed a lot. It provides the availability of intruder detection, early warning and location in the pipeline security monitoring system.This paper analyzes the typical characteristics of the threats to the pipeline safety, presents a new type of distributed optical fiber vibration sensing system based on polarization detection. By employing a Faraday rotator mirror (FRM), the sensor only responses to the change of transmission light's polarization caused by rapid vibration, and eliminates slow polarization change interference or random polarization drifting. Through analyzing the intensity of the reflected sensing light and the time information, it is able to locate and recover the vibration signal simultaneously. The operation performance of the proposed device is theoretically analyzed and experimentally demonstrated in this paper.The main work of this paper covers the following aspets:(1)A large number of relevant researches on the distributed fiber sensors is carefully studied. Compared with several common sensing technology based on the optical time-domain reflectometer(OTDR) and the interference structure, distributed optical fiber vibration sensing system based on polarization detection is proposed.(2)The hypocenter vibration model and earth vibration model are formed after analyzing the vibration signal feature aroud the pipeline.The evolution of polarization during the transmission is described by Jones matrix. According to the cross-power spectral density correlation analysis, the time delay between the vibration signal and the sensing signal is calculated to locate the disturbance point.(3) Based on the theoretical research, the experimental system is constructed by applying a voltage-controlled polarization controller to change the polarization of the transmission light as the interference. While rapping the steel pipeline to simulate the actual vibration.
